Transaction 7593c8fba9f31c00a057a2ea339d31b9a6d6f936aa0fc75e41a5c52291923ecc

1 Input
2 Outputs
  • 7593c8fba9f31c00a057a2ea339d31b9a6d6f936aa0fc75e41a5c52291923ecc:0
  • value  200000000
    address  12d4cLTavMWrNVXto9N9sBiDEXyp9TyXbV
  • 7593c8fba9f31c00a057a2ea339d31b9a6d6f936aa0fc75e41a5c52291923ecc:1
  • value  1313562144
    address  374e5m7R3Qn7fHwyx7yFKPm56rXSA41cCN